io.atlasmap.validators.StringLengthValidator.class Maven / Gradle / Ivy
Go to download
A single aggregated bundle which contains all AtlasMap library artifacts including modules.
???? 4 u
D E F??? G H I J
K L M N
O
P
Q R
D
S
T U
V
W
X
Y Z [ \ ] violationMessage Ljava/lang/String; minLength I maxLength scope Lio/atlasmap/v2/ValidationScope; 7(Lio/atlasmap/v2/ValidationScope;Ljava/lang/String;II)V Code LineNumberTable LocalVariableTable this .Lio/atlasmap/validators/StringLengthValidator; supports (Ljava/lang/Class;)Z clazz Ljava/lang/Class; LocalVariableTypeTable Ljava/lang/Class<*>; Signature (Ljava/lang/Class<*>;)Z validate 7(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;)V target Ljava/lang/Object; validations Ljava/util/List; id -Ljava/util/List; T(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;)V X(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;Lio/atlasmap/v2/ValidationStatus;)V
validation Lio/atlasmap/v2/Validation; status !Lio/atlasmap/v2/ValidationStatus; value
StackMapTable J u(Ljava/lang/Object;Ljava/util/List;Ljava/lang/String;Lio/atlasmap/v2/ValidationStatus;)V
SourceFile StringLengthValidator.java ! ^ java/lang/Integer java/lang/String _ ` ) a b = 0 9 c d e f io/atlasmap/v2/Validation g h i j java/lang/Object k l m n o j p q r s t ,io/atlasmap/validators/StringLengthValidator io/atlasmap/spi/AtlasValidator ()V java/lang/Class isAssignableFrom io/atlasmap/v2/ValidationStatus ERROR isEmpty ()Z length ()I setScope #(Lio/atlasmap/v2/ValidationScope;)V setId (Ljava/lang/String;)V toString ()Ljava/lang/String; format 9(Ljava/lang/String;[Ljava/lang/Object;)Ljava/lang/String;
setMessage setStatus $(Lio/atlasmap/v2/ValidationStatus;)V java/util/List add (Ljava/lang/Object;)Z ! ! " # ? %*? *? *? *+? *,? *? *? ? $ " ! " # $ $ % % 4 % &